Fenagh Visitor Centre
Fenagh, Co. Leitrim

The town of Fenagh, in County Leitrim, is steeped in history. The Fenagh Visitor Centre allows you to learn about the history of Fenagh through a wonderful array of photographs.

Fenagh Visitor Centre, in County Leitrim, has an indoor soft play centre, coffee shop and heritage centre. Bring the children in and let them play in the soft play area while you relax with a cup of coffee or learn about the history of Fenagh through the wonderful array of pictures which adorn the walls.

Explanations, photographs, descriptions and maps can be viewed in the heritage centre, highlighting Fenagh's rich history. There is also a selection of photographs and other items available for purchase. The centre features the cosy Dolmen Café, which offers a selection of refreshments and tasty snacks. Sit down and enjoy a freshly brewed tea or coffee in the friendly and relaxed surroundings. There is a selection of hot and cold refreshments to suit all tastes and ages including soft drinks, soup, sandwiches, toasties, wraps, and a children's menu.

Children will be entertained in the Monk's Den, an indoor soft play area. The space is based on a monastery theme over three tiers. There is a specially designed and segregated toddler area. The den is also available for children's parties and other special occasions.

The centre is available for conferences and meetings, with modern facilities which can accommodate up to 30 people for training or meeting purposes.

Pre-booking is required for the soft play area and historic tours. Bookings can be made online.

Tips from locals

In the visitor centre you can book a guided tour of Fenagh Abbey, one of the oldest monastic sites in Ireland.
